An AI agent automates new patient intake and triage 24/7 via website chat and SMS.

For a high-volume practice handling sports injuries, fractures, and joint pain, the initial point of contact is critical. Manual intake for urgent cases can delay scheduling and frustrate patients in pain. An AI agent can instantly qualify inbound inquiries, collect necessary information, schedule appointments based on urgency and provider specialty, and send pre-visit instructions, ensuring patients are routed correctly from the first interaction.

25-40% reduction in front-office administrative tasksMedical Group Management Association (MGMA)
This agent acts as a virtual front-desk coordinator. It engages website visitors through a chat interface, asking guided questions about injury type, location, pain level, and preferred location. Using rule-based triage protocols, it identifies urgent cases (like potential fractures) for immediate care scheduling (OrthoAccess) and routes elective consults to appropriate specialists. It integrates with the practice management system to check real-time availability, book appointments, and trigger automated confirmation messages and intake forms.

An AI agent streamlines prior authorization and insurance verification for surgeries and advanced imaging.

Prior authorization is a major bottleneck in orthopedic practices, delaying care and consuming significant staff time. Denials or slow turnaround from payers can push back surgery dates, frustrating patients and surgeons alike. Automating the initial data gathering, form population, and submission tracking can dramatically accelerate this process and reduce the administrative burden on clinical coordinators.

50-70% reduction in manual staff time spent on initial auth submissionCAQH Index
This agent integrates with the EHR to identify scheduled procedures requiring authorization. It automatically extracts relevant clinical notes, patient demographics, and insurance details. It then populates and submits electronic prior authorization (ePA) forms to payer portals according to each payer's specific rules. The agent tracks submission status, sends alerts for missing information, and notifies staff only when human intervention is required for a peer-to-peer review or denial appeal, acting as a powerful force multiplier for the revenue cycle team.

Does Hinsdale Orthopaedics need to replace its current EMR or practice management systems to use AI?
No. Modern AI agents are designed to integrate with existing systems like EMRs, practice management software, and scheduling platforms through secure APIs. They act as an intelligent layer on top of current infrastructure, automating tasks that flow between systems (like pulling data from the EHR for prior auth) or engaging patients through familiar channels like the website and SMS, without requiring a costly and disruptive system replacement.

How does AI handle HIPAA compliance and patient data security for a medical practice?
Any AI deployment for a healthcare provider like Hinsdale Orthopaedics must be built on a HIPAA-compliant foundation. This includes Business Associate Agreements (BAAs) with vendors, encryption of data in transit and at rest, strict access controls, and comprehensive audit logging. AI agents should be designed with a 'privacy by design' approach, accessing only the minimum necessary data to perform their specific task and never storing sensitive PHI unnecessarily.
